from db_utils import exec_hive_stat2
import dateutil
from db_utils import execute_hive_expression,get_hive_timespan
import argparse
import pandas as pd
"""
Usage:
python get_requests.py \
--start 2016-03-01 \
--stop 2016-03-01 \
--release test \
--priority \
--min_count 1
"""
def get_requests(start, stop, table, trace_db = 'a2v', prod_db = 'prod', priority = True, min_count=50):
query = """
SET mapreduce.input.fileinputformat.split.maxsize=200000000;
SET hive.mapred.mode=nonstrict;
-- get pageviews, resolve redirects, add wikidata ids
DROP TABLE IF EXISTS %(trace_db)s.%(trace_table)s_pageviews;
CREATE TABLE %(trace_db)s.%(trace_table)s_pageviews AS
SELECT
year,month,day,
client_ip,
user_agent,
x_forwarded_for,
ts,
pv2.lang,
pv2.title,
id
FROM
(SELECT
year,month,day,
client_ip,
user_agent,
x_forwarded_for,
ts,
pv1.lang,
CASE
WHEN rd_to_page_title IS NULL THEN raw_title
ELSE rd_to_page_title
END AS title
FROM
(SELECT
year,month,day,
client_ip,
user_agent,
x_forwarded_for,
ts,
normalized_host.project AS lang,
REGEXP_EXTRACT(reflect('java.net.URLDecoder', 'decode', uri_path), '/wiki/(.*)', 1) as raw_title
FROM
wmf.webrequest
WHERE
is_pageview
AND webrequest_source = 'text'
AND normalized_host.project_class = 'wikipedia'
AND agent_type = 'user'
AND %(time_conditions)s
AND LENGTH(REGEXP_EXTRACT(reflect('java.net.URLDecoder', 'decode', uri_path), '/wiki/(.*)', 1)) > 0
) pv1
LEFT JOIN
(SELECT
*
FROM
prod.redirect
WHERE
rd_from_page_namespace = 0
AND rd_to_page_namespace = 0
AND lang RLIKE '.*'
) r
ON
pv1.raw_title = r.rd_from_page_title AND pv1.lang = r.lang
) pv2
INNER JOIN
%(prod_db)s.wikidata_will w ON pv2.title = w.title AND pv2.lang = w.lang;
DROP TABLE IF EXISTS %(trace_db)s.%(trace_table)s_editors;
CREATE TABLE %(trace_db)s.%(trace_table)s_editors AS
SELECT
client_ip,
user_agent,
x_forwarded_for
FROM
wmf.webrequest
WHERE
uri_query RLIKE 'action=edit'
AND %(time_conditions)s
GROUP BY
client_ip,
user_agent,
x_forwarded_for;
DROP TABLE IF EXISTS %(trace_db)s.%(trace_table)s_reader_pageviews;
CREATE TABLE %(trace_db)s.%(trace_table)s_reader_pageviews AS
SELECT
p.*
FROM
%(trace_db)s.%(trace_table)s_pageviews p
LEFT JOIN
%(trace_db)s.%(trace_table)s_editors e
ON (
p.client_ip = e.client_ip
AND p.user_agent = e.user_agent
AND p.x_forwarded_for = e.x_forwarded_for
)
WHERE
e.client_ip is NULL
AND e.user_agent is NULL
AND e.x_forwarded_for is NULL;
DROP TABLE IF EXISTS %(trace_db)s.%(trace_table)s_clients_per_item;
CREATE TABLE %(trace_db)s.%(trace_table)s_clients_per_item AS
SELECT
id,
COUNT(*) as n
FROM
(SELECT
client_ip,
user_agent,
x_forwarded_for,
id
FROM
%(trace_db)s.%(trace_table)s_reader_pageviews
GROUP BY
client_ip,
user_agent,
x_forwarded_for,
id
) a
GROUP BY
id;
-- remove disambiguation pages and pages with colon in title
DROP TABLE IF EXISTS %(trace_db)s.%(trace_table)s_eligible_reader_pageviews;
CREATE TABLE %(trace_db)s.%(trace_table)s_eligible_reader_pageviews AS
SELECT pv.*
FROM
(SELECT
p.*
FROM
%(trace_db)s.%(trace_table)s_reader_pageviews p
JOIN
%(trace_db)s.%(trace_table)s_clients_per_item c
ON (p.id = c.id)
WHERE
c.n >= %(min_count)s
) pv
LEFT JOIN
(SELECT
lang,
page_title
FROM
%(prod_db)s.page_props
WHERE
propname = 'disambiguation'
AND lang RLIKE '.*'
AND page_namespace = 0
GROUP BY
lang,
page_title
) d
ON
(pv.lang = d.lang and pv.title = d.page_title)
WHERE
d.page_title IS NULL
AND pv.title NOT RLIKE 'disambig'
AND pv.title NOT RLIKE ':';
DROP TABLE IF EXISTS %(trace_db)s.%(trace_table)s_requests;
CREATE TABLE %(trace_db)s.%(trace_table)s_requests AS
SELECT
CONCAT_WS('||', COLLECT_LIST(request)) AS requests
FROM
(SELECT
client_ip,
user_agent,
x_forwarded_for,
CONCAT('ts|', ts, '|id|', id, '|title|', title, '|lang|', lang ) AS request
FROM %(trace_db)s.%(trace_table)s_eligible_reader_pageviews
) a
GROUP BY
client_ip,
user_agent,
x_forwarded_for
HAVING
COUNT(*) <= 1000
AND COUNT(*) > 1;
DROP TABLE IF EXISTS %(trace_db)s.%(trace_table)s_eligible_reader_pageviews;
DROP TABLE IF EXISTS %(trace_db)s.%(trace_table)s_clients_per_item;
DROP TABLE IF EXISTS %(trace_db)s.%(trace_table)s_reader_pageviews;
DROP TABLE IF EXISTS %(trace_db)s.%(trace_table)s_editors;
DROP TABLE IF EXISTS %(trace_db)s.%(trace_table)s_pageviews;
"""
params = { 'time_conditions': get_hive_timespan(start, stop, hour = False),
'trace_db': trace_db,
'prod_db': prod_db,
'trace_table': table,
'min_count': min_count
}
exec_hive_stat2(query % params, priority = priority)
if __name__ == '__main__':
parser = argparse.ArgumentParser()
parser.add_argument( '--start', required=True, help='start day')
parser.add_argument( '--stop', required=True,help='start day')
parser.add_argument('--db', default='a2v', help='hive db')
parser.add_argument('--release', required=True, help='hive table')
parser.add_argument('--priority', default=False, action="store_true",help='queue')
parser.add_argument('--min_count', default=50)
args = parser.parse_args()
print(args)
db = args.db
table = args.release.replace('-', '_')
start = args.start
stop = args.stop
get_requests( start,
stop,
table,
trace_db = db,
prod_db = 'prod',
priority = args.priority,
min_count = args.min_count)
